The sources — and these are real
Where the world’s fresh water actually is.
Everything above this line is a design fiction. This is not. Fifty rivers and fifty lakes, drawn from the same public-domain Natural Earth survey ATLAS uses, ranked by a figure computed from the very shapes on the map — great-circle length along each river’s drawn centreline, spherical area inside each lake’s drawn ring. No tile server, no map provider, no key: the map is drawn here, on a canvas, from coordinates that ship with the page.
On top of that survey sits a third layer of a different kind: the amber diamonds are bottled-water sources — the springs, wells and aquifers the famous bottles actually come out of. That layer is curated, not measured, and the page says so everywhere it appears, because “famous” is a judgement and no survey defines it.
A fourth layer, off until you ask for it, is the water you cannot see: groundwater — aquifers, reservoirs, geysers, hot and karst springs, oases and the qanats that have watered dry country for three thousand years. That one is harvested: every mark is a real Wikidata object at its own recorded coordinate, and the rule that chose it is arithmetic rather than judgement.

What this ranks, exactly. It ranks what the 1:50m survey draws, which is not the same as the world. A river is measured only across the segments carrying its name, so the Nile — split in this survey into Nile, Albert Nile and Victoria Nile — measures short, and the Amazon appears under its Portuguese name, Amazonas. The Caspian is absent from the lake layer entirely. Generalised centrelines run shorter than real channels, so every river figure here is a floor, not a length. The lake areas are closer: Superior computes to 84,840 km² against a surveyed 82,100, Baikal to 32,074 against 31,722. Nothing here is a discharge or a volume, because this survey carries neither and inventing them is what the fiction upstairs is for.
What the curated layer is, and what was actually checked. The register holds bottled-water sources. It is a shortlist, not a survey: there is no dataset of famous water, so somebody decided, and that somebody should be visible rather than hidden behind a number. What could be checked mechanically was — every coordinate is tested against the same public-domain Natural Earth country polygons ATLAS draws from, and a point that did not fall inside the country it claimed is not in the file. Each entry carries the tier it survived, printed with the entry rather than in a footnote. The gaps are deliberate. Only some carry a bottling year and fewer a mineral figure, because a guessed number and a measured one look identical once they are set in the same typeface. And nothing here is ranked: the list is ordered by country, since there is no such measurement as the best water and pretending otherwise is what the fiction upstairs is for.
What the harvested layer is, and where it is thin. The groundwater layer comes from Wikidata. Each class is cut by a rule, and the rule is the point. Aquifers, geysers, karst springs, oases and qanats ship whole: the classes are small enough that choosing among them would be an editorial act. That is also the most striking thing here — there are thirteen aquifers on Earth that Wikidata records with a coordinate, so the world’s great groundwater bodies are almost entirely unmapped as objects, and this layer shows that rather than padding it. Reservoirs are the largest by published capacity, but only where the figure survived a test: Wikidata stores those volumes in twelve different units — and two that are not volumes at all — so every claim was converted to cubic metres and divided by the reservoir’s own surface area. A mean depth outside 0.5–200 m means the pair cannot both be right, which cut 212 claims including one reservoir filed at 10,000 km³, sixty times Kariba. Springs and hot springs are ranked by how many Wikipedias carry an article — a notability proxy, named as one on every entry, because 76,972 springs carry a coordinate and nothing ranks them honestly. Every coordinate was then tested against the same Natural Earth country polygons used above; where Wikidata’s country tag disagreed with its own coordinate the polygon won, which moved a Ukrainian reservoir out of Belarus. Each entry links to the Wikidata item it came from, because a harvested figure you cannot trace is a figure you cannot check. And look at where the marks are. They crowd into Europe and Iran and thin out across Africa and central Asia, which is not where the world’s groundwater is — it is where the people writing the encyclopedia live. A harvested layer inherits its source’s blind spots, and this one is a map of attention as much as of water.

Read this first. Every figure below was written by a designer, not returned by a laboratory. No water was drawn, bottled or tested; there is no batch, no assay and no certificate. These are the numbers the fictional brand would print on its can, set the way a real spec sheet is set because that is the design problem — and labelled here so nobody mistakes the typography for evidence.
What is deliberately not here. The original page carried an ISO 17025 accreditation, a PFAS figure in parts per trillion, a twelve-stage purity protocol, non-detect results across four hundred parameters, carbon-negative logistics and conservation partnerships. Every one of those named an authority, a measurement or an obligation that does not exist, and none of them survived the rebuild. A spec sheet for an imaginary drink can be beautiful; it cannot borrow a laboratory’s voice. The only figures on this page that are measurements rather than design are in the sources map, and they are measurements of rivers and lakes, not of this.
